The Castle of Nice was a military citadel. Built on top of a hill, it stood overlooking the bay of Nice from the 11th to the 18th centuries. It was besieged several times, most notably in 1543 and 1691, before being taken by French troops in 1705 and finally destroyed in 1706 by order of Louis XIV.

From Tuesday to Sunday, the famous flower market takes its place at the heart of Cours Saleya and sets the pace for mornings in the Vieux Nice. An essential stop for holidaymakers on the Côte d'Azur, the people of Nice have also come here to do their shopping since 1861. Flower arrangements, bouquets, plants, single flowers, all colours are there on the stalls with their unforgettable scents.

This delightful public park in the city centre runs from Place Massena, linking the Promenade des Anglais to the old town of Vieux Nice. Developed during the late 1800’s, Jardin Albert 1er is one of Nice’s oldest public gardens; a large lawn in the centre is surrounded by palm trees, fragrant roses, carob trees, junipers as well as various plants from Japan, China, the Americas, Australia and the Himalayas.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Salade Niçoise

A classic Niçoise salad made with tuna, olives, tomatoes, hard-boiled eggs, and anchovies.

Lunch/Dinner Contains seafood and eggs

Socca

A thin, crispy chickpea pancake, a popular street food in Nice.

Snack Vegetarian, vegan, and gluten-free

Pissaladière

A Niçoise tart made with caramelized onions, anchovies, and olives.

Lunch/Dinner Contains seafood

Ratatouille

A traditional Provençal stew made with vegetables like eggplant, zucchini, and bell peppers.

Lunch/Dinner Vegetarian and vegan
